Heinichen Last Name Facts

Where Does The Last Name Heinichen Come From? nationality or country of origin

The surname Heinichen is found most in Germany. It may occur as:. For other potential spellings of this name click here.

How Common Is The Last Name Heinichen? popularity and diffusion

It is the 504,985th most frequently held surname world-wide, held by approximately 1 in 11,211,609 people. The last name Heinichen is predominantly found in Europe, where 65 percent of Heinichen reside; 64 percent reside in Western Europe and 64 percent reside in Germanic Europe.

Heinichen is most numerous in Germany, where it is carried by 401 people, or 1 in 200,762. In Germany it is primarily concentrated in: Saxony, where 29 percent reside, North Rhine-Westphalia, where 17 percent reside and Lower Saxony, where 11 percent reside. Barring Germany Heinichen occurs in 11 countries. It is also found in The United States, where 22 percent reside and Paraguay, where 10 percent reside.

Heinichen Family Population Trend historical fluctuation

The occurrence of Heinichen has changed over time. In The United States the number of people carrying the Heinichen surname rose 2,920 percent between 1880 and 2014.
